The Northern Side of Portion of Friend Street, in the City of
Wellington, exempted from the Provisions of Section 117 of
the Public Works Act, 1908, subject to a Condition as to the
Building-line.
———
CHARLES FERGUSSON, Governor-General.
ORDER IN COUNCIL.
At the Government House at Wellington, this 25th day of
May, 1925.
Present :
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ers conferred by the
Public Works Act, 1908, and of all other powers in
anywise enabling him in this behalf, His Excellency the
Governor-General of the Dominion of New Zealand, acting
by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council
of the said Dominion, doth hereby approve of the following
resolution passed by the Wellington City Council on the tenth
day of November, one thousand nine hundred and twenty-one,
viz. :—
“ The Wellington City Council, being the local authority
having control of the streets in the City of Wellington,
hereby declares that the provisions of section one hundred
and seventeen of the Public Works Act, 1908, shall not
apply to all that portion of the northern side of Friend Street
beginning at its junction with Parkvale Road and extending
for a distance of approximately twenty-four chains to a
point opposite to the eastern boundary of Church Street in
the said city ” ;
subject to the condition that no building or part of a building
shall at any time be erected on the land adjoining the northern
side of the portion of Friend Street (described in the Schedule
hereto) within a distance of thirty-three feet from the centre-
line of the said portion of street.
———
SCHEDULE.
THE northern side of all that portion of street in the Wellington Land District, City of Wellington, known as Friend Street,
commencing at its junction with Parkvale Road and extending for a distance of approximately 24 chains to a point
opposite the eastern boundary of Church Street. As the said
portion of street is more particularly delineated on the plan
marked P.W.D. 53297, deposited in the office of the Minister
of Public Works at Wellington, in the Wellington Land District, and thereon coloured red.
F. D. THOMSON,
Clerk of the Executive Council.

The Eastern Side of Portion of Beach Street, in the Borough of
Petone, exempted from the Provisions of Section 117 of the
Public Works Act, 1908, subject to a Condition as to the
Building-line.
———
CHARLES FERGUSSON, Governor-General.
ORDER IN COUNCIL.
At the Government House at Wellington, this 25th day of
May, 1925.
Present :
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ers conferred by the
Public Works Act, 1908, and of all other powers in any-
wise enabling him in this behalf, His Excellency the Governor-
General of the Dominion of New Zealand, acting by and with
the advice and consent of the Executive Council of the said
Dominion, doth hereby approve of the following resolution
passed by the Petone Borough Council on the sixteenth day
of March, one thousand nine hundred and twenty-five, viz. :—
“ That the provisions of section one hundred and
seventeen of the Public Works Act, 1908, and its amend-
ments, shall not apply to all that portion of the eastern side
of Beach Street upon which the following land, at present
owned by James Wilson and Archibald McLeod Wilson, of
Wellington, builders, as tenants in common, abuts—
namely, 31·8 perches—being Lots 73 and part of Lot 74
on deposited plan 51, part of Section 5, Hutt District, and
being all the land in certificate of title, Volume 154, folio 221,
Wellington Registry ” ;
subject to the condition that no building or part of a building
shall at any time be erected on the land adjoining the eastern
side of the portion of Beach Street (described in the Schedule
hereto), within a distance of thirty-three feet from the centre-
line of the said portion of street.
———
SCHEDULE.
THE eastern side of all that portion of street, situated in the
Wellington Land District, Borough of Petone, known as
Beach Street, fronting a proposed subdivision of Lot 73 and
part Lot 74 on deposited plan 51, part of Section 5, Hutt
District. As the same is more particularly delineated on the
plan marked P.W.D. 62383, deposited in the office of the
Minister of Public Works at Wellington, in the Wellington
Land District, and thereon coloured red.
F. D. THOMSON,
Clerk of the Executive Council.

Prescribing Particulars to be furnished to Fire Board by Owner
of Property insuring outside New Zealand.
———
CHARLES FERGUSSON, Governor-General.
ORDER IN COUNCIL.
At the Government House at Wellington, this 25th day of
May, 1925.
Present :
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ers and authorities
conferred on him by section forty-three of the Finance
Act, 1924 (hereinafter referred to as “ the said section ”),
and of all other powers and authorities enabling him in that
behalf, His Excellency the Governor-General of the Dominion
of New Zealand, acting by and with the advice and consent
of the Executive Council of the said Dominion, doth hereby
prescribe that the particulars to be given upon giving the
Fire Board of a Fire District the notification required by
subsection two of the said section shall be the particulars
set out in the Schedule hereto ; and doth hereby declare
that the form set out in the said Schedule may be used for
the purpose of giving such notification as aforesaid.
———
SCHEDULE.
To the Fire Board of the Fire District.
PURSUANT to the provisions of section 43 of the Finance
Act, 1924, I notify you that I have insured property as
under :—
- Full name of owner :
- Address of owner :
- Occupation of owner :
- Name of insurer (company, partnership, corporation,
or person with whom insurance is effected) : - Is insurer an insurance company not carrying on
business in New Zealand ? - Is insurer an office or branch outside New Zealand
of an insurance company carrying on business in
New Zealand ? - General description of property :
- Situation of property :
- Approximate value of property :
- Amount of insurance :
- Amount of premium :
- Period in respect of which premium is payable :
- Date when insurance was effected :
And I hereby certify that to the best of my knowledge
and belief the foregoing particulars are true and correct.
Signature of owner :
Witness to signature—
Signature of witness :
Address :
Occupation :
NOTE.—This Return requires to be forwarded within
forty-eight hours after the owner effects the insurance, in
accordance with section 43, Finance Act, 1924.
F. D. THOMSON,
Clerk of the Executive Council.
